The role of housekeeper is an opportunity to join a large team of dedicated staff. The role of a housekeeper is essential in maintaining a clean and safe environment for patients, staff and visitors. You would be involved in cleaning all areas of the hospital including areas which require specialist cleaning such as theatres, the hospital sterilization unit and isolation rooms. The role is varied and staff may be expected to work as part of a team or alone.

The cleaning service operates 24/7 and uses a variety of different equipment both manual and mechanical.

All aspects of training will be covered and you will be joining a supportive and friendly team where all our staff are valued for the contribution they make in maintaining high standards of cleaning.

Main duties of the job

The duties include general cleaning duties on wards and departments throughout the hospital. A cleaning service is also provided to the staff residential accommodation. Some areas require specialist cleaning including theatres, hospital sterilisation unit and isolation rooms.

Worcestershire Acute Hospitals NHS Trust is a large acute and specialised hospital trust that provides a range of local acute services to the residents of Worcestershire and more specialised services to a larger population in Herefordshire and beyond.

The Trust operates hospital-based services from three sites in Kidderminster, Redditch and Worcester

Our workforce is nearly 6,800 strong, and our caring staff are recognised as providing good and outstanding patient-centred care. You could be one of them.
